在不同的服务器或系统之间通过API接口进行交互时,两个系统之间必须进行身份的验证,以满足安全上的防抵赖和防篡改。 通常情况下为了达到以上所描述的目的,我们首先会想到使用非对称加密算法对传输的数据进行签名以验证发送方的身份,而RSA加密算法是目前比较通用的非对称加密算法,经常被用于数字签名 ...
目的,在每次请求的时候,对每次传的参数,进行解析,验签,并返回解码后的参数, 以json传递 例子背景: IOT平台提供对外可访问的接口, 需要对所有参数的传递做到 不泄露 认证的目的 所以需要在每次请求的时候: 对需要传递的参数进行加密, byte encrypt encrypt content, AEB F DA A A BEF String hexStr parseByte HexStr ...
2020-09-15 20:24 0 717 推荐指数:
在不同的服务器或系统之间通过API接口进行交互时,两个系统之间必须进行身份的验证,以满足安全上的防抵赖和防篡改。 通常情况下为了达到以上所描述的目的,我们首先会想到使用非对称加密算法对传输的数据进行签名以验证发送方的身份,而RSA加密算法是目前比较通用的非对称加密算法,经常被用于数字签名 ...
引入依赖 也用到了fastjson打印参数 , 如果引了就不需要(也可以根据自己的来打印) ...
Spring AOP切面的时候参数的传递 Xml: AppBean: POJO: AOP: ...
验签: 背景: 在实际工作中,有些敏感接口如支付接口,接口定义了一个入参为auth,在请求接口时,必须传入正确的auth,接口才会返回正确的数据,否则不处理,目的是为了加强接口的安全性 原理: 每次发送请求时都需要携带一个参数,可能是header里面 ...
1.业务背景 因为公司做的系统跟淘宝有很大一部分的联系,所以涉及电商类的接口比较多,今天在对接礼品公司,对方的接口需要使用加签的方式。像这些接口,双方为了保证数据参数在传输过程中未经过篡改,一般都会需要对接口数据进行加签(不知道为什么像大淘客之类的却没有做这一块,可能是为了使用 ...
url后参数的转码与解码 执行结果: jdk相关说明: ...
本文已迁移到:https://yuque.com/page/luan.ma/ssm-aop-verification 欢迎收藏我的新博客地址:http://luan.ma ...